Kuala Lumpur, 23 June 2026 – Malaysia’s workforce is moving faster than many organisations in adopting artificial intelligence, creating a widening gap between employee capability and how work is structured, according to Microsoft’s 2026 Work Trend Index.
The study found that 24% of workers in Malaysia are classified as Frontier Professionals, the most advanced AI users in the research, compared with 16% globally. These workers are not only using AI more frequently, but also applying it in more sophisticated ways to analyse information, solve problems, evaluate options and think creatively.
